What is the pH Scale?
What is the difference between an acid and a base?
The pH scale is a numerical scale used to measure the acidity or alkalinity of a solution. The scale ranges from 0 to 14, with 7 being neutral. On the acidic side, the scale ranges from 0 to 6.9, and on the alkaline side, it ranges from 7.1 to 14. The lower the number, the more acidic the substance.
An acid is a substance that donates hydrogen ions, while a base is a substance that accepts hydrogen ions. This difference leads to distinct effects on the pH level of a solution.

Many people mistakenly believe that all acidic substances are hazardous, but this is not necessarily the case. The pH level of a substance is just one factor to consider when assessing its potential risks.
Additionally, some individuals may think that the pH scale only applies to laboratory settings, but in reality, it has practical applications in everyday life, such as in the food and cosmetics industries.
